Keyboard icon indicating copy to clipboard operation
Keyboard copied to clipboard

Faster language switching

Open PanderMusubi opened this issue 1 year ago • 6 comments

Checklist

  • [X] I made sure that there are no existing issues - open or closed - to which I could contribute my information.
  • [X] I made sure that there are no existing discussions - open or closed - to which I could contribute my information.
  • [X] I have read the FAQs inside the app (Menu -> About -> FAQs) and my problem isn't listed.
  • [X] I have taken the time to fill in all the required details. I understand that the bug report will be dismissed otherwise.
  • [X] This issue contains only one feature request.
  • [X] I have read and understood the contribution guidelines.
  • [X] I optionally donated to support the Fossify mission.

Feature description

Faster language switching by swiping the space bar to left or right.

signal-2024-07-28-195849_002

Why do you want this feature?

Most user use two languages, English and their native non-English language. Personally, I use four different language and I expect there are also a considerable amount of users that use three languages.

Currently, a long press on the key with the small globe icon is needed, followed by a press on the desired language. When writing in multiple languages, this should be offered in a much quicker way.

Additional information

In AnySoftKeyboard this is done with a special button (marked with the pink dot) that steps (only in one direction) to the next available language.

signal-2024-07-28-195841_002

PanderMusubi avatar Jul 28 '24 18:07 PanderMusubi

I like being able to use the spacebar to move the cursor, so how about swiping up or down instead of left or right on the spacebar? This wouldn't impede any existing functionality while not requiring any additional buttons.

PhilippKosarev avatar Aug 08 '24 00:08 PhilippKosarev

Sure, or make it configurable.

PanderMusubi avatar Aug 08 '24 08:08 PanderMusubi

Or the option to add a language button Or a language button on the toolbar

AndyM48 avatar Aug 12 '24 14:08 AndyM48

I think a settings toggle could be added to move the Emoji key to the long-press effect of the Enter key. That would open up the language switch key for (1) a quick cycling through the enabled layouts on short-press, and (2) the current selection menu on long-press.

NaeemBolchhi avatar Aug 20 '24 02:08 NaeemBolchhi

I would prefer anything without a long press as I switch languages so often. Long press is then annoying. For people writing in multiple languages chancing languages is used more often than e.g. a comma or quotation mark.

PanderMusubi avatar Aug 20 '24 08:08 PanderMusubi

I had submitted a PR (#40) to do this but it was rejected.

Made the keyboard unusable for me so I switched to FUTO Keyboard.

ronniedroid avatar Sep 15 '24 12:09 ronniedroid